Output 5638b8aca866034c6220361043e3497e8280860aa244ead30cc9300fda433e23:81

value
22555187
script pubkey
OP_0 OP_PUSHBYTES_20 d7d0042d071f25a7394e79cf61f6cf4a0bc8f56d
address
bc1q6lgqgtg8ruj6ww2w088krak0fg9u3atdxq854c
transaction
5638b8aca866034c6220361043e3497e8280860aa244ead30cc9300fda433e23
spent
true